Chest Tattoo Pain Map
Chest Area | Pain Level (1-10) | Why This Pain Level |
|---|---|---|
Sternum (Breastbone) | 8-9/10 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 | Bone-on-bone vibration, minimal cushioning |
Ribs (Side Chest) | 7-8/10 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 | Thin skin, bone proximity, breathing movement |
Collarbone | 7-8/10 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 | Directly over bone, thin skin |
Upper Pecs (Men) | 5-6/10 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 | More muscle cushioning, tolerable |
Outer Chest | 4-6/10 ⭐⭐⭐⭐ | Away from bone, more tissue |
Underboob (Women) | 6-8/10 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 | Near ribs, sensitive skin, varies by person |

Chest Tattoo Aftercare Challenges
Challenge 1: Bra Strap Contact (Women)
Solution: Go braless for first week if possible. Use strapless bras, sports bras, or soft bralettes. Avoid underwire for 2 weeks.
Challenge 2: Sleeping Position
Solution: Sleep on back for first 3-5 nights. Use extra pillows for elevation. Avoid side/stomach sleeping.
Challenge 3: Clothing Friction
Solution: Wear loose-fitting shirts. Avoid tight tops, necklaces, and seat belts rubbing area for 2 weeks.
Challenge 4: Shower Difficulties
Solution: Quick lukewarm showers. Gently pat dry immediately. Avoid hot water directly hitting tattoo.
Challenge 5: Visibility While Healing
Solution: Plan tattoo during time off work/social events if possible. Schedule 3-4 days recovery minimum.

Pros & Cons of Chest Tattoos
✅ Advantages:
Symbolic placement: Over heart = deep personal meaning
Easy concealment: All shirts/blouses hide completely
Large canvas: Room for detailed, meaningful pieces
Protected from sun: Clothing shields from UV damage = better aging
Personal viewing: You see it daily (mirror, photos)
Gender-versatile: Works beautifully for all bodies
Intimate reveal: Shown only when you choose
❌ Disadvantages:
High pain level: Sternum/ribs are among most painful areas
Breathing challenges: Deep breathing during ribs/sternum work difficult
Healing discomfort: Clothing contact, bra issues for women
Long sessions: Large chest pieces require 6-8+ hour endurance
Body changes: Weight gain/loss, pregnancy can distort design
Sweating issues: Summer heat, exercise creates healing challenges
⚠️ Pain Reality Check: Sternum tattoos are genuinely painful. Many clients describe it as 8-9/10 pain—worse than most other placements. If this is your first tattoo, seriously consider starting elsewhere to build pain tolerance. If you're committed to chest placement, start with outer chest (less painful) before attempting sternum work.

Gender-Specific Considerations
For Women:
Pregnancy Considerations:
Breast/torso tattoos may stretch during pregnancy
Underboob/sternum designs often maintain better than side ribs
Consider waiting until after having children if concerned
Many women get chest tattoos post-children without issues
Breast Augmentation/Reduction:
Plan tattoos AFTER surgery, not before
Existing tattoos may be distorted by breast surgery
Consult plastic surgeon about tattoo placement if planning surgery
Mammogram Considerations:
Tattoos don't prevent mammograms
Dense ink may obscure small details on imaging
Inform technician about tattoos during screening
For Men:
Muscle Development:
Significant muscle gain can stretch chest tattoos
Maintain stable physique for best longevity
Bodybuilders should get tattoos at target weight
Chest Hair:
Artist will shave area for tattoo session
Hair grows back through tattoo (doesn't damage it)
Some men prefer shaving chest permanently post-tattoo for visibility
Hair can partially obscure finer details

Chest Tattoo FAQs
How painful are chest tattoos?
Depends on exact placement. Sternum: 8-9/10 (very painful). Upper pecs (men): 5-6/10 (moderate). Outer chest: 4-6/10 (tolerable). Underboob (women): 6-8/10 (painful, varies individually).
Can I work out after getting a chest tattoo?
No heavy chest exercises for 2 weeks minimum. Light cardio okay after 3-4 days. Avoid bench press, push-ups, pull-ups for 14 days. Sweat irritates healing tattoo.
Will my chest tattoo stretch if I gain weight?
Moderate weight changes (5-10kg): minimal effect. Significant changes (20kg+): noticeable stretching/distortion possible. Pregnancy: depends on placement—sternum holds better than side ribs.
Should I get chest tattoo before or after having children?
Personal choice. Sternum/underboob tattoos often survive pregnancy well. Side chest/rib pieces may stretch. Many women get chest tattoos before, during, and after children—no universal rule.
How long until I can wear normal bras after underboob tattoo?
Minimum 1 week braless or soft bralettes only. Week 2: Can try soft bras without underwire. Weeks 3-4: Resume normal bras. Let comfort guide you—if it irritates tattoo, wait longer.
Can men with chest tattoos get clear mammograms?
Yes. Tattoos don't prevent imaging, though dense ink may obscure tiny details. Inform healthcare providers about tattoos. Not a medical concern for vast majority.
